Colchester Town and Country Show, Lower Castle Park, today, 10am-5pm

Organisers have laid on more family entertainment than ever, including a children’s farm where you can meet lots of spring baby animals as well as a welcome return for the Suffolk Punch Heavy Horse Display Team.

Other activities include a dog and duck show, living history, ferret racing, Devilstick Peat childrens’ entertainer and circus workshop, the have-a-go Totally Terriers display team, bottle feeding lambs and kids and goat show, miniature ponies and birds of prey flying displays, arts, crafts, gifts trade stands and marquees with besom broom making, spinning and weaving and pole latheing among the demonstrations. Today the event hosts the companion dog show. Visitors are invited to bring along a canine friend and have a go, with all proceeds from entries going to Marie Curie Cancer Care.

Craeftiga, the Sutton Hoo Festival of Craftsmanship, Sutton Hoo, near Woodbridge, today.

Inspired by the Sutton Hoo treasures, the festival celebrates the skills and legacy of the Anglo Saxon craftsman - from metalwork to weaving and much more. There will also be children’s craft activities and the chance to climb aboard the Anglo Saxon replica ship Sae Wylfing. From 1.30pm-2.30pm todaythere will be an informal talk and handling session in the exhibition hall where you can see replicas of the Sutton Hoo artefacts and get a sense of how the original items would have looked and felt 1,400 years ago.

Megaslam Wrestling, Brackenbury Sports Centre, 2.30pm, today.

Featuring competitors from around the world, it’s been touring since 2009; selling out shows across the country. It was started by Brad Taylor, who used to compete himself.

Matches will include the Megaslam World Championship clash, tag team thriller and this year’s spectacular Megaslam rumble which will feature all the wrestlers in the ring at the same time.
